Course Description
In this advanced video game production class, you’ll get expert guidance, plus the freedom to focus on your favorite parts of the game creation process. Lectures will cover high-level modeling techniques, rigging and level game play elements to design custom mods. You’ll explore advanced features of 3ds Max, Maya, ZBrush and the latest Unreal Engine 3. Students will work in small teams, so each can focus on their role in a mock game design studio. Roles include game designer, level designer, modeler, texture artist, rigger or any combination of these. All elements created in the class are designed to take home so you can continue to learn and explore new areas of game design.
